Saag Paneer

Steps:

  1. Fried the onion, tomato + chilli in ghee
  2. Added garlic + ginger
  3. Added spices, and toasted for a minuted
  4. Added thawed spinach + a little water as needed
  5. Brown and cut the paneer (see notes)
  6. Simmered for 5 minutes
  7. Blended with hand blender to smooth consistency
  8. Added paneer
  9. Simmered for a few more minutes

Notes:

I browned the paneer on both sides, cut in half, and flipped each half and browned on both sides again (browning the previous "outside" edge). Then I cut it into ~16 pieces. The pieces were too big, and hard to cut with a spoon. Either cut into like 48 pieces, or maybe simmer longer, or something.

The paneer was also pretty under seasoned, again maybe smaller chunks, and simmering longer or something.
